Drain Clearing Service in Denver, CO
Drain clearing services involve removing blockages and buildup from household plumbing systems to ensure proper water flow. These services typically cover projects such as clearing clogged kitchen and bathroom drains, main sewer line cleaning, and addressing slow-draining sinks or tubs. Homeowners often seek drain clearing when experiencing backups, foul odors, or persistent slow drainage, and they should consider providing details about the location of the blockage, the type of drain affected, and any previous issues to help determine the best approach.
Before requesting drain clearing services, property owners usually want to understand the scope of work involved and what methods will be used to clear the blockage. It’s helpful to know whether the service involves traditional snaking, hydro-jetting, or other techniques, and if any preliminary inspections, such as camera assessments, are included. Clarifying these points can assist in planning for any necessary repairs or maintenance and ensure the service aligns with the specific needs of the property’s plumbing system.

Common Drain Clearing Service Jobs
Drain clearing services remove blockages to restore proper water flow in residential plumbing systems.
Kitchen drain cleaning addresses clogs caused by grease, food debris, and soap buildup.
Bathroom drain clearing resolves slow or backed-up sinks, tubs, and shower drains.
Main sewer line cleaning helps prevent backups and overflows in the primary drain line.
Storm drain clearing ensures proper drainage during heavy rain to prevent flooding.
Drain maintenance involves routine inspections and cleaning to keep drains flowing smoothly.
Drain Clearing Service Questions
What causes drain clogs? Common causes include hair, grease, food particles, and debris buildup within pipes.
How can I tell if my drain is clogged? Signs include slow draining water, gurgling sounds, or water backing up in sinks or tubs.
Are drain clearing services safe for plumbing systems? Yes, professional drain clearing uses techniques that protect pipes and prevent damage.
What types of drains can be cleared? Services typically cover kitchen sinks, bathroom drains, toilets, and outdoor stormwater drains.
